Transaction b999575eee04888703ab71c6303af3057d5c694db3635139260a1dd72a729e36
1 Input
2 Outputs
- b999575eee04888703ab71c6303af3057d5c694db3635139260a1dd72a729e36:0
- b999575eee04888703ab71c6303af3057d5c694db3635139260a1dd72a729e36:1
value 9255087
address 38T2FvhPNAAzgSWRVtpjeXLLzzsf4LJtVj
value 874052
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c